first you need a brush (a redline skeleton of the form you want the blocking volume in)
then select the brush, rightclick on the "volume"-icon (the fourth icon under the "add texture"-icon) and select BlockingVolume
that's it

you have to edit the volume to make it block nades and fire too...
this is the way you can do that:

go to the blocking volume properties; go to CollisionAdvanced;
and set
OR
bBlockZeroExtentTraces to True
OR
bBlockNonZeroExtentTraces to False

you have to choose the right one, i thought it was bBlockNonZeroExtentTraces, but I'm not very sure....
